Comparative evaluation of apical microleakage of three different obturating material using stereomicroscopy

Aims: The aim of this study is to assess the microleakage of three root canal filling materials using a dye penetration method and comparison of the differences in microleakage of each obturating material. Methods and Materials: Thirty human first premolars with intact roots, extracted for orthodontic purpose, were selected for the study. Root canal treatment was done in all the specimens and randomly divided into three groups (ten teeth in each group) and obturated with three different obturating materials (i.e. Themafill, ProPoints and GuttaFlow). All the specimens were subjected to thermocycling and then stored in 100% humidity at 37oC for 48 hours. Microleakage was measured using dye penetration technique using stereomicroscope. Static analysis: Done by using tukey test and ANOVA. Result: The amount of microleakage was minimum with Thermafil (0.01-0.12 mm) as compared to GuttaFlow (0.11-0.23 mm) and ProPoint (0.17-0.30 mm). On comparison of mean microleakage between the groups Thermafill has got minimum (p<0.001). Conclusion: Study concluded that Thermafill is the better material for obturation as it exhibits minimum microleakage than ProPoint and Guttaflow.
